## Deployment

The Fernquist transcoding farm deploys as a fleet of stateless workers behind the Marrowgate scheduler. Workers pull jobs over mutually authenticated channels only; no inbound ports are exposed. Each node reads its configuration at boot from a sealed bundle, and any mismatch against the signed manifest aborts startup. Reviewers should verify that the settings below align with the hardening checklist before approving a rollout. The current production bundle contains the following values.

settings of fafog-haduf:
ZORIX_PIN=4648
ZORIX_METRICS_HOST=metrics.zorix.paliqsys.corp
ZORIX_LOG_LEVEL=info
ZORIX_TENANT=druix

**Ticket: Config drift on BounceSift processor**

The email bounce processor in the Larkfield environment has drifted from the values committed in the release branch. Retry windows and suppression thresholds no longer match, which likely explains the duplicate suppression entries reported Tuesday. Please reconcile before the Thursday cut. For reference, the currently deployed configuration on the live node reads as follows.

config for yajep-yahof:
[briax]
port = 9200
region = outer-2
host = briax.nelvrocorp.test
team = raleth
timeout_ms = 1500
retries = 1

14:32 — Load test ramp against the Quillgate checkout flow reached 1,800 virtual shoppers, at which point the payment-intent service began returning intermittent 503s. Mara from the Fennwick platform team confirmed the connection pool to the ledger cache was exhausted, not the database itself. We paused the ramp, doubled the pool size in staging, and reran the 15-minute soak with no errors. For reviewers verifying the fix, the exact staging build under test is recorded below.

build token for kagaf-hahof: htk14_9d3d4d26d7d8de

# Env file — Cartwheel dispatch, driver-assignment heuristic
# Scope: staging only. Do not promote to prod.
# The heuristic weights (proximity, shift balance, refusal rate) are tuned
# for the Velmont pilot region and will misbehave elsewhere.
# Review notes: heuristic service runs unprivileged; it reads weights
# read-only from the tuning store and writes nothing back.
# Only one sensitive value exists in this file: the tuning-store access
# credential, consumed at boot and never logged.
# That credential is set on the following line.

secret setting of faduf-bahop: LEDGER_TOKEN8=c3b363be